introduction
Haeseong is a small, quiet coastal town in South Korea. It appears to be an ordinary place, but it's gripped by collective hysteria due to the Y2K bug and apocalyptic theories.
The Wunderkinder Project
Decades ago, at the Haeseong orphanage, scientist Ha Won-do conducted atrocious biological experiments on orphaned children in an attempt to develop a serum for eternal life, creating the first "enhanced humans" (Wunderkinders).
Among the children experimented on, one possessed perfect cellular regeneration. After a fire caused by the explosion of Un-jeong's powers destroyed the orphanage, the scientist was imprisoned, and the chemical waste from his experiments was illegally buried in the city dump.
The Church of Eternal Salvation
After being released from prison in 1999, Ha Won-do returns to Haeseong under the guise of an apocalyptic cult exploiting the fear of the year 2000. His real objective is to locate the organ of the "Child of Eternity" in order to synthesize a cure for the side effects of his formulas, unleashing chaos in the city.

The Landfill Incident and the Revelation
In late 1999, desperate for money to travel before her heart condition worsened, Chae-ni convinced the three of them to fake her kidnapping to demand a ransom from her grandmother. They headed to the Haeseong illegal dump to film the video, but the pressure got the better of her: Chae-ni suffered a massive heart attack and collapsed in their arms. As Ro-bin and Kyung-hoon screamed in panic, intubating her to try and revive her near some buried chemical barrels, Lee Un-jeong, the cold and methodical municipal official recently arrived from Seoul to investigate complaints about illegal waste, emerged from the shadows. Un-jeong surveyed the scene with absolute detachment, saw Chae-ni's lifeless body, and immediately accused them of a staged kidnapping that ended in murder, pulling out his notebook to call the police.
However, amidst the chaos and Un-jeong's harsh accusations, the impossible happened: Chae-ni took a breath and suddenly came back to life.
What no one knew at the timeโnot even Chae-ni herselfโwas that the miraculous operation that saved her life in childhood was no ordinary surgery. During clandestine experiments at the old orphanage, Chae-ni had the heart of the "Child of Eternity" implanted in herโthe original test subject with perfect cellular regeneration. For this reason, Chae-ni is biologically incapable of truly dying.
Upon resurrection, the mixture of the chemical compound that was leaking from the barrels of Project
History III
Wunderkinder reacted like everyone else. As her heart rate spiked from the shock of seeing the official threatening them, Chae-ni teleported herself a few meters away for the first time. Before the astonished gaze of Un-jeongโwho had no choice but to let them go, confused to see that the "corpse" was alive and had vanished into thin airโthe group took advantage of the confusion to flee the landfill, marking the beginning of the transformation that would change their lives forever.
